Warning Signs to Watch For

Not sure if you need Knee Injury Treatment? Here are warning signs Stockbridge homeowners and athletes should watch for:

  • Persistent Swelling: Swelling that lasts more than a week after an injury may need imaging and intervention.
  • Locking or Catching: If the knee locks during walking or stairs, you might have a meniscal issue needing specialist care.
  • Night Pain: Pain that wakes you up and doesn't ease with rest could signal a deeper injury.
  • Sport-Related Instability: Repeated giving way during soccer or baseball at local fields needs assessment to prevent more damage.
  • Heat-Related Flare-ups: High humidity in Stockbridge can worsen tendon pain and swelling after outdoor work.
  • Post-Accident Pain: Any knee pain after a car collision on I-75 or local roads should be checked for internal injury.

Conservative Care vs Interventional Care: What Stockbridge Homeowners Should Know

Choosing between basic rehab and interventional procedures matters when pain limits activity or work. Here is a quick comparison to guide your choice.

FactorConservative CareInterventional Care
Best WhenMinor strains and rehab-friendly painPersistent pain or clear structural issues
Typical Timeline4-8 weeks1-6 weeks for injections plus rehab
Cost LevelLower overallHigher upfront due to imaging and procedures
Skill RequiredTherapist-guided exercisesClinician trained in image-guided injections
LongevityGood with complianceOften longer relief when combined with rehab
Stockbridge ConsiderationBetter for early-season sports trainingBetter when humid weather worsens inflammation
